The canyon of the river Botunya near Varshets
Nature has done its job well here and the bizarre rock formations and holes make you feel like you are on the moon and not in Bulgaria 🙂 An extremely beautiful place, suitable for great photos. The canyon is 94 km away. from Sofia and 23 km. from Vratsa. It is reached by car and stops on the left side of the road (if you are coming from Sofia). After parking cross over to the other side of the road and follow a beaten path in the bushes. Along it, there are several forks to the right that will reveal the canyon to you.

Tsar Asen Mine
Proof that a dangerous place full of toxic water and poison can gain incredible popularity thanks to selfie fashion. A deserted lake full of toxic turquoise waters, this place is like taken out of a fantasy movie and is visited almost daily by many vloggers, influencers and photographers. Extremely suitable location for photos if you shoot with a drone. The lake is located near the eponymous village of Tsar Asen, which is close Pazardzhik.

the Devetashka cave
Of course, we can't miss the Devetashka Cave in this article. A unique place that has even become a film set for famous Hollywood productions. This is a large karst cave, which in the past was inhabited by cavemen for tens of thousands of years, and today is home to over 30,000 bats. With a length of nearly 2.5 km, a height of 60 m and a total area of about 20,400 m2, Devetashka is one of the largest caves in Bulgaria, although only a small part is accessible to regular tourists.

Satan Dere
Sheitan Dere, or as it is also known as this place "Devil's Canyon", is located under the wall of the dam Studen Kladenets and is one of the little known landmarks in The Rhodopes. Seen from above, the natural landmark visualizes a landscape from another planet, through which the Arda River passes. The canyon is of volcanic origin and has frozen lava from the long-extinct volcano. In general, the whole region around Studen Kladenets Dam is uniquely beautiful, so Satan Dere is just one of the reasons to visit it.
